On December 25 2012 12:23 VayneAuthority wrote:
Show nested quote +
On December 25 2012 11:52 pfff wrote:
On December 25 2012 09:44 VayneAuthority wrote:
On December 25 2012 07:02 ZERG_RUSSIAN wrote:
Cho actually beats Darius really hard

I thought it was the other way around at first but after playing both sides pretty extensively it's Cho's lane without heavy camping

Also Vlad is doable but you have to build pure damage with the goal of bursting him before he bursts you


you have to be playing some pretty bad darius then. I have hundreds of games on him and have never even come close to losing vs a cho. even if you die from a gank you will always beat him in a straight up fight unless you are underleveled.

funny post although you probably dont realise it. Yes, bad cho's lose extremely hard vs heroes that are very strong at lvl 1-5 (darius, riven, xin, ...). The whole point is that good cho's dont fall into that trap and know how to survive these levels without losing lane too hard (e.g. freezing lane correctly right before tower before they can push you into tower at lvl 2-3 and back real quick for a ward and a dorans, ...).
You telling him he "must be playing some pretty bad chos" makes your whole post seem stupid as bad cho's are exactly the ones who lose lane vs darius while good chos go equal (and outscale) or win it.
Darius cant do anything to cho with his skillset and any semblance of potential jungler presence in the first few levels and gets outfarmed later on, just think for a moment about their respective skillsets and cooldowns and then come up with a scenario where darius kills cho after level 5 and then think about the fact taht cho completely outscales him (especially taking into account the way both of them will have to build in this type of lane)


wrong, I played at 2k+ last season and I am 1900 this season. Good chos get crushed too by my darius. If you dont start dorans blade as darius you are doing it wrong. If you want to test your cho against my darius by all means, message me and ill gladly do the matchup with you.


Ye, I play a lot of Darius as well, and I used to shit on Cho with exactly a doran's start, but since the new patch, I really feel that I cant pressure him hard enough to take a big enough advantage (with the move from cs gold to automatic gold), simply because of jungle pressure. Even when I zone him completely (which is dangerous cuz of jungle and cho's huge range to assist a jungle gank), push him into tower and go b quickly for more dorans/wards/... I feel that this just isnt a big enough advantage to really win the lane. Then after lvl 9+ it becomes difficult to kill him without ignite due to his strong disengage and tankiness, and after lvl 11 it seems to become imposssible. I don't know, maybe I am really winning these lanes but not as hard as I would like to with darius hehe, it just seems to become a way too passive lane for a darius to really shine in my opinion.

On December 27 2012 05:43 little fancy wrote:
Maybe some people hate me for it and I have the assumption that it is more of a solo queue type thingy (although I saw a jungle Darius in competitive korean play at OGN Winter), but I have recently played a lot vs Darius in the jungle and it owned pretty hard.

How would you run him in the jungle? I tried it by myself and tbh I'm not too impressed with his early level jungling, but maybe that's not too important since his ganks are pretty decent from my experience (especially when the lane you gank has a good CC by itself already)?


If your lane can get the opponent's flash off them, they're dead. Been playing a good bit of jungle Darius lately, but I don't have a fantastic build order for you since I get fed every game. Built Wriggles->BC->FM->Hydra... big damage, tanky, useful in teamfights. I want to experiment with mobility boots for epic funs, his cleartime is already superfast.
